Assistive Technology (TRAID) | AIM Independent Living Center

Provides free loans of assistive technology. Assistive technology is any device that can be used to improve the functional abilities of people with disabilities or short-term injuries. Available items include wheelchairs, walkers, Rollators, canes, crutches, ramps, grab bars, Hoyer lifts, adaptive seating, shower chairs, commodes, wander alarms, weighted items, adaptive utensils, laptops, iPads and deaf and blind/low vision technology. We also have learning aids, toys and games for early intervention, as well as pediatric equipment. Free delivery may be available.

ITHACA FREE CLINIC | ITHACA HEALTH ALLIANCE

The Free Clinic provides the following FREE service for uninsured and under-insured members of our community:By Appointment Only Medical Clinics: Free primary health care, medical testing, woman's health services, and employment physicals for the uninsured.Chronic Care Program: Targeting at-risk individuals who need help managing persistent pain, diabetes, asthma, high blood pressure and other chronic conditions.Financial Advocacy: Helping find creative solutions to relieving financial dept for those struggling to keep up with medical bills.Ithaca Health Fund: Offering grants to those needing help affording diagnostic tests, treatments and prescriptionsInsurance Navigation: Help in qualifying and enrolling uninsured individuals in various Medicaid plansHolistic Health Care Services that include chiropractic, therapeutic massage, herbal therapy, and acupuncture.Occupational Therapy: In partnership with Ithaca CollegeFood Pharmacy: Registered Dietitian services and free health Food supportPrescription Medication Support: Assistance in obtaining free or low-cost prescription medications like insulinOptometry Clinic and Optician Services: Free dilated eye exams and glaucoma screenings and free prescription eye glasses Community Health Education: Conducting free community chronic disease health screenings, educational seminars, lectures and open houses to deliver crucial health information to our community.Traditional Reiki healing as a service.Occupational Therapy Clinic, hosted by Ithaca CollegeChiropractic servicesThe Mission of the Free Clinic is to facilitate access to health care for all, with a focus on the needs of uninsured persons.501(c)(3) charity and accepts voluntary donations, including medical supplies and equipment. Limited storage space, contact clinic before making a donation.
